You need to find the original rom for your phone, both region AND provider(if you were getting invalid serial on teh htc website then your phone is provider locked, so for example you would need to look for the german t mobile rom, if you got your phone from t mobile germany)
Once you have your original rom you can then use sd card method to remove hspl and restore to factory rom. You can only do this with your original shipped rom.

Instal HSPL2 from the HSPL/HSPL2 thread in rom development. (It is fully reversable, your warranty is only temporarily void)
Then go to the Leo Official Roms thread in rom development, first post, first link, brings up a list of folder
1.42
1.48
1.66
etc etc
Look in the 1.66 folder for one with 'HTC' and 'WWE' in the title (world wide english and HTC unbranded)
Download it, and with your phone connected to usb, run the exe you downloaded.
THis WILL of course reset your phone completely, so be sure and back up your data first.
